Video editing is a dynamic and evolving profession. To truly excel in this field, you must cultivate your abilities. It's about beyond just tapping buttons; it's about telling a compelling story through visual elements. This involves a deep understanding of narrative, cinematic choices, and the power of sound.
A skilled video editor employs a collection of tools to manipulate raw footage into a cohesive and powerful final product. They meticulously trim scenes, adjust colors, and embed sound elements to create a seamless and impactful viewing adventure.
Mastering the art of video editing is a perpetual process that requires passion, creativity, and a willingness to constantly learn.
Transform Raw Footage to Cinematic Magic: A Guide to Video Editing
Have you ever stumbled upon a pile of raw footage and felt the desire to transform it into something truly magical? Video editing is the skill that breathes life into those still moments, weaving them together into a cohesive and captivating narrative. This guide will empower you with the core tools and techniques to turn your raw footage into cinematic masterpieces.
- Dive the world of editing software. There are countless options available,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Experiment to find the one that best suits your needs and workflow.
- Master the fundamentals of cutting, trimming, and splicing footage to create a smooth and engaging flow. Remember, pacing is crucial in storytelling.
- Add sound effects and music to enhance the emotional impact of your video. Sound can elevate a scene from mundane to memorable.
Avoid be afraid to experiment with different editing styles and techniques. The possibilities are truly limitless. With practice and passion, you can unlock your inner filmmaker.
